Why Worry About Expenses?


 What Are Expenses?

    Expenses are the money you spend to run your business. The big question is why worry about them? Here are a few basic reasons:

  • You will know how much money your business is making.
  • You will lower the amount you have to pay in taxes.
  • You will need them organized if you are audited by the IRS.
  • You will stay within your budget.
  • You can grow your business by knowing how much cash flow you have.

How Often You Should Track Expenses?



    The exact timing will vary, but the general times are daily, weekly, monthly, quarterly, and yearly. Here are a few common items and a recommended schedule:


  • Small expenses should be tracked either daily or weekly.
  • Most set expenses will be on a monthly basis.
  • Estimated Quarterly Tax Payments, and often Sales Tax Payments usually are on a quarterly schedule.
  • Yearly expenses are important to keep track of because it is easy to forget things that only come once a year.

Ways to Keep Track of Expenses

    There are many ways to keep track of expenses, and this is a personal choice that works for you! There is no right or wrong way, as long as it gets done. Below is a list of some common ways to track your expenses, and keep them organized:


  • Use any type of spreadsheet. ( There are  a lot of free ones found on the web.)
  • Use accounting software. (There are many types of both free and paid software, so choose the one that most fits for you.)
  • Hire a Bookkeeper or Accountant ( If you have a small business, then a Bookkeeper can be a great choice for you. If you have a more complex business, then an Accountant may be a better choice.)
  • You can keep it as simple as a notebook, however, this is not the recommended way. This is not the preferred method for and IRS audit and may end up costing you money.
